Inspection Summary

This restaurant was inspected by the Chicago Department of Public Health on September 30, 2024. The inspection type was "Canvass" and resulted in a Fail outcome.

This establishment is classified as Risk 1 (High), which determines the inspection frequency and focus areas.

The inspector documented 1 violation during this inspection, including 1 critical violation that required immediate attention.

Violations Cited by Chicago Health Inspector

1
Violation #38
CRITICAL
INSECTS, RODENTS, & ANIMALS NOT PRESENT - Comments: FOUND APPROXIMATELY 7-10 SMALL FLIES IN THE DISHWASHING AREA, 2 SMALL FLIES IN THE FOOD PREP AREA AND 2 SMALL FLIES IN THE DINING AREA. INSTRUCTED TO MINIMIZE SMALL FLY ACTIVITY. RECOMENDED CONTACTING PEST CONTROL. PRIORITY FOUNDATION VIOLATION. 7-38-020(A). CITATION ISSUED.
Pests spread numerous diseases through contamination.
No pests or animals allowed in facility.
No evidence of pests; No live animals except service animals; Effective pest control program.
